A driver who was fleeing police crashed their car into a Dayton house early Friday morning.
Police said the driver ran a stop sign on Dryden Road in Moraine in front of an officer, then continued driving. Police pursued the driver into Dayton, where he lost control and crashed into a house in the 1400 block of S. Broadway Street. The car crashed through a fence and then into the home’s foundation.

The driver is being treated at Miami Valley Hospital.
Police said the driver didn’t have a license, and it’s unknown if drugs or alcohol were a factor.
No one in the home was injured.
